Small Business Management ProgramOur three year Small Business Management Program is designed to serve owners of established businesses in Umatilla and Morrow Counties.

The SBM screening process is designed to assess the applicant’s level of commitment to their business, potential conflicts of interest, and possible competition with other program participants. The goal is to create an environment in which owners can freely discuss their common and individual opportunities and challenges. A long list and wide variety of businesses have participated in our SBM program during its 20 years of operation.

Each group of business owners meets monthly (September through July) in an informal “round table” setting.

Our SBM Instructor / Counselor visits each participating business monthly to help implement group discussion topics and address specific business issues.

Examples of topics covered in detail with each business during the 3-year SMB program:

  • Financial Management
  • Marketing
  • Human Resources Management
  • Systems and Controls

Developing appropriate records, long range goals, and evaluation procedures are essential to the SBM process.

Confidentiality is key to the credibility and success of the program.

A certificate is awarded for the completion of each year.

An informal SBM Alumni program offers continuing educational and networking opportunities.
